The first thing filter-branch does is to create a temporary
directory, either ".git-rewrite" in the current directory
(which may be the working tree or the repository if bare),
or in a directory specified by "-d". We then chdir to
$tempdir/t as our temporary working directory in which to run
tree filters.
After finishing the filter, we then attempt to go back to
the original directory with "cd ../..". This works in the
.git-rewrite case, but if "-d" is used, we end up in a
random directory. The only thing we do after this chdir is
to run git-read-tree, but that means that:
1. The working directory is not updated to reflect the
filtered history.
2. We dump random files into "$tempdir/.." (e.g., if you
use "-d /tmp/foo", we dump junk into /tmp).
Fix it by recording the full path to the original directory
and returning there explicitly.
